Good governance key priority of govt: DPM Shrestha



BIRATNAGAR: Deputy Prime Minister and Minister for Home Affairs, Narayan Kaji Shrestha, has said the government is committed to addressing every incident of the violation of rule lawfully.

In his address to a press meet organized by the Press Centre Morang here on Monday, the Home Minister said the police administration has been already directed to ensure the complete prevention of cross-border crimes including smuggling and other affairs prohibited by the law.

He said increased surveillance along the border of late has led to the rise in revenue collection. The Home Minister utilized the forum to put his argument that federalism along with the guarantee of ‘identity’ is inevitable.

According to the Home Minister, the government highly prioritizes the campaign to promote good governance, and a high-level commission will be formed to deal with the recent gold smuggling scam.
